Notice of Public Hearing
Town of Moriah
The Town of Moriah will hold a public hearing on July 18, 2024 at 5:45 pm at the Town of Moriah Court House, 42 Park Place, Port Henry, NY 12974 for the purpose of hearing public comments on Moriah’s community development needs, and to discuss the possible submission of one or more Community Development Block Grant (CDBG) applications for the 2024 program year. The CDBG program is administered by the New York State Office of Community Renewal (OCR), and will make available to eligible local governments approximately $15,000,000 for the 2024 program year for housing, economic development, public facilities, public infrastructure, and planning activities, with the principal purpose of benefitting low/moderate income persons. The Town of Moriah is applying for single-family home rehabilitation in CDBG funds to approximately $500,000. The hearing will provide further information about the CDBG program and will allow for citizen participation in the development of any proposed grant applications and/or CDBG program or proposed project(s) will be received at this time. The hearing is being conducted pursuant to Section 570.486, subpart I of the CGR and in compliance with the requirements of the Housing and Community Development Act of 1974, as amended.
The Town of Moriah Court House is accessible to persons with disabilities. If special accommodations are needed for persons with disabilities, those with hearing impairments, or those in need of translation from English, those individuals should contact Matthew Brassard, Supervisor at 38 Park Place, Suite 1 Port Henry, NY 12974 or by calling 518-546-8631 at least one week in advance of the hearing date to allow for necessary arrangements. Written comments may also be submitted to Matthew Brassard, Supervisor until July 22, 2024 at 4:00 pm.

Water & Sewer Billing Reminder!
The Town of Moriah Water & Sewer Clerk Rose M. French will be collecting Water and Sewer rents beginning January 2, 2024. Billing and due dates are as follows:
Bill January 1st for January, February and March; Due February 3rd
Bill April 1st for April, May and June; Due May 3rd
Bill July 1st for July, August and September; Due August 3rd
Bill October 1st for October, November and December; Due November 3rd
All rents will be collected through November 3, 2024, after which any unpaid balance will be levied on to the Town & County taxes which come out in January 2025.
PLEASE REMIT BOTTOM PORTION OF INVOICE WHEN PAYING YOUR BILL TO ENSURE CREDIT TO THE PROPER ACCOUNT AND BE SURE TO INCLUDE YOUR TELEPHONE NUMBER.
If you have any questions at all regarding your water and sewer bill, please call the Town Clerk’s Office at 518-546-3341.

Seeking Request for Proposals-alterations to existing Beach House
The Town of Moriah is seeking bids to support the design and alteration of an existing structure at Champ RV Park-Beach House located at 54 Dock Lane Port Henry, NY on Lake Champlain.
The contractor will be required to draft a proposed design with the assistance of the Town and Code Officers. The structure is to be altered into a 2-unit short term rental.
In addition to drafting the design the contractor will be responsible for all the scopes of construction to meet the new design requirements.
Please schedule a site visit to walk through the structure. A visit can be arranged by calling the Town Hall at 518-546-8631 or councilmangilbo@townofmoriahny.gov

REVALUATION PROJECT
The Town of Moriah will be conducting a Revaluation Project for the year 2024. The assessors for the Town and / or Data Collectors from the Essex County Real Property Tax Service Office will be visiting each parcel to verify property information in an effort to maintain a fair and equitable assessment roll.

Effective immediately the Town will no longer be charging for the disposal of elctronic waste at the Transfer Station. The Town will still accept electronic waste as per DEC regulations but the manufacturer is now responsible for any associated recycling costs.
